Antarmuka IDataModelConcept (dbgmodel.h)
Objek apa pun yang mewakili model data yang terdaftar dengan nama atau terdaftar untuk tanda tangan jenis tertentu harus menerapkan konsep ini dan menambahkannya ke objek model data melalui IModelObject::SetConcept.
Klien yang membuat model data mengimplementasikan antarmuka ini. Ini paling sering dikonsumsi oleh manajer model data itu sendiri.
Warisan
IDataModelConcept mewarisi dari IUnknown.
Metode
Antarmuka IDataModelConcept memiliki metode ini.
IDataModelConcept::AddRef Metode IDataModelConcept::AddRef menambah jumlah referensi untuk antarmuka pada objek. |
IDataModelConcept::GetName Jika model data tertentu terdaftar dengan nama default melalui metode RegisterNamedModel, antarmuka IDataModelConcept model data terdaftar harus mengembalikan nama tersebut dari metode ini. |
IDataModelConcept::InitializeObject Model data dapat didaftarkan sebagai visualizer kanonis atau sebagai ekstensi untuk jenis asli tertentu melalui metode RegisterModelForTypeSignature atau RegisterExtensionForTypeSignature manajer data. |
IDataModelConcept::QueryInterface Metode IDataModelConcept::QueryInterface mengambil pointer ke antarmuka yang didukung pada objek. |
IDataModelConcept::Release Metode IDataModelConcept::Release mengurangi jumlah referensi untuk antarmuka pada objek. |
Persyaratan
Persyaratan | Nilai |
---|---|
Header | dbgmodel.h |